DeepSource helps you automatically find and fix issues in your code during code reviews, such as bug risks, anti-patterns, performance issues, and security flaws. It takes less than 5 minutes to set up with your Bitbucket, GitHub, or GitLab account. It works for Python, Go, Ruby, Java, and...

  • VIZOR is generally considered a good tool for those looking to create VR content easily and efficiently. Its browser-based interface and lack of coding requirements make it accessible, though it may not offer all the advanced features needed for complex projects that professional developers would require.

Why this product is good

  • VIZOR is a user-friendly platform designed for creating and experiencing virtual reality (VR) content. It offers an accessible way for individuals and businesses to create immersive VR presentations and experiences directly in the browser without needing extensive technical expertise. It supports features like drag-and-drop interfaces, scene templates, and 3D object import, making it appealing for educators, marketers, and creators who want to explore VR.
